On Vacation: A Model of Female Leadership

 

One of the most notable achievements of On Vacation is that 54.42% of our company’s leadership positions are held by women. This percentage reflects our belief that women should not only be part of companies but also lead them. Through our vision and principles, we have demonstrated that gender equality is possible not only in words but also in concrete actions. On Vacation has been a pioneer in building an environment where women play a central role in decision-making.

 

A particularly relevant aspect is that 46.34% of our women hold leadership positions within the organization. This means that almost half of the key positions are held by women, which not only reflects our commitment to equity, but also the transformational capacity of female leadership. This representation in leadership positions is critical to ensuring that women continue to be drivers of change and innovation within the company.

 

Promoting Gender Equity

 

On On Vacation, we are constantly working toward gender equality. This includes closing the pay gap and implementing policies that ensure job descriptions are not based on gender. In our workplace, women have the same opportunities for growth and development as men. We foster an environment where talent, dedication, and skills are the only factors that determine a person’s advancement.

 

Our commitment to pay equity and equal opportunity is one of the cornerstones of our culture. This commitment aligns with the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), specifically SDG 5 (Achieve gender equality and empower all women and girls). Within this goal, we highlight targets 5.1 (eliminate all forms of discrimination against women and girls), 5.5 (ensure women’s full and effective participation in decision-making), and 5.c (promote policies and legislation that support gender equality). On Vacation works every day to meet these goals, promoting inclusive policies that seek to eliminate any barriers to the development and advancement of women in our company.

 

Cultural Diversity: A Pillar of Innovation

 

Women's empowerment is not limited to gender equality alone; it is also deeply connected to cultural diversity. In On Vacation, we understand that diversity is a driver of innovation and creativity. That is why we have a team of women from different cultural communities. 10.40% of our women are from the Raizal community, 9.83% are from the Wayúu community, 3.56% of the women in the company are from the Kocaima community, and 3.42% are from the Tikuna communities. This cultural diversity is not only a reflection of our commitment to inclusion but also an added value that allows us to have a broader and more enriched perspective in everything we do.

 

Each of these women, in addition to contributing their professional talents, also enriches the organization with their unique cultural identity, which strengthens our value proposition and enables us to respond more effectively to our customers' needs. Women from diverse communities are not only occupying key positions, but are demonstrating, through their work, that diversity is a source of strength and growth.

 

Social Commitment: Inclusion for All

 

Women's Empowerment on On Vacation also extends to the inclusion of all people, regardless of age, race, gender, or disability. We believe in the value of each individual’s work and development, regardless of their background or differences. At On Vacation, we promote an inclusive culture where every person is respected and valued, and where women have access to the same opportunities as men to grow and thrive.

 

A great example of this commitment can be found in our Silver Weaver sewing room in San Andres. San Andresa project in which we are actively involved. In this initiative, a team of women over the age of 60 leads the production, demonstrating that empowerment knows no age. These women, who have overcome age-related barriers, are a testament to the transformative power of work and the dignity that each person can bring, regardless of their stage of life.

 

These types of initiatives are also aligned with SDG 10.2, which promotes the reduction of inequalities. We are committed to ensuring that all women, regardless of their age, status or place of origin, have the opportunity to contribute and develop. These initiatives not only change the lives of the people involved, but are also part of our effort to generate a positive impact in the communities in which we operate.
